
Backend Careers in alto ∙ Page 2
67 Remote & work from home jobs online





Software Engineer III - Java Backend Developer
189174-INVESTMENT TECHNOLOGY-NY/DE · Palo Alto, United States Of America · Onsite

Hybrid AI/HPC Network Development Engineer - Networking
xAI · Palo Alto, United States Of America · Hybrid

Hybrid Software Engineer, New Grad - Infrastructure
Palantir · Palo Alto, United States Of America · Hybrid

Hybrid Software Engineer, Internship - Infrastructure
Palantir · Palo Alto, United States Of America · Hybrid

Hybrid Senior/Staff Fullstack Visualization Engineer
Woven-by-toyota · Palo Alto, United States Of America · Hybrid


Hybrid Principal Machine Learning Engineer (Palo Alto, CA, US, 94304)
SAP Software Solutions | Business Applications and Technology · Palo Alto, United States Of America · Hybrid


Hybrid Senior Software Engineer (Full-Stack) - Crypto Web Experiences
BitGo · Palo Alto, United States Of America · Hybrid

Hybrid Senior Software Engineer, Payroll
Velocity Global · Palo Alto, United States Of America · Hybrid

Hybrid Member of Technical Staff, Back-end & API
Parallel Web Systems · Palo Alto, United States Of America · Hybrid



Hybrid Software Engineer - Orchestrated Application Recovery
Rubrik · Palo Alto, United States Of America · Hybrid

Hybrid Engineering Manager - Enterprise Experience
Rubrik · Palo Alto, United States Of America · Hybrid

Systems Engineer, IDE Performance
Augment Code · Palo Alto, United States Of America · Onsite
- Professional
- Office in Palo Alto
About Augment Code
Augment Code is the only AI coding assistant built for professional software engineers working in large, production‑grade codebases. Our Context Engine understands your entire repo, enabling developers to stay in flow while writing, reviewing, and understanding code. Backed by top‑tier investors and trusted by engineering teams at leading tech companies, Augment Code is redefining how modern software is built.
About the Role
As a Systems Engineer at Augment Code, you'll play a crucial role in bridging the gap between complex AI research and real-world SAAS applications. You'll be tasked with designing, implementing, and maintaining our infrastructure, ensuring high availability and optimal performance for AI-driven services catered to a global user base.
The IDE Performance role focuses on performance and stability in our IDE integrations. You’ll tackle complex issues—such as memory leaks, CPU bottlenecks, and UI freezes—while building the foundational components that power plugins and client SDKs across multiple IDEs. Your work will directly improve responsiveness, reliability, and developer productivity for customers working at scale.
In this role you will
- Investigate and resolve performance bottlenecks, memory issues, and stability problems in IDE plugins (with emphasis on IntelliJ in the short-term).
- Profile and optimize JVM-based systems for efficiency, responsiveness, and reliability.
- Design and evolve shared abstractions and SDK components that enable consistent multi-IDE support.
- Establish robust testing, monitoring, and profiling practices to detect regressions early.
- Collaborate with product, infrastructure, and client engineers to ensure seamless integration with backend services.
- Drive architectural improvements that make IDE integrations more scalable and maintainable.
You have
- Bachelor's degree in Computer Science, Engineering, or a related field. A Master's degree is an advantage.
- 5+ years of experience as a Systems Engineer, with exposure to AI-driven environments or SaaS platforms being a significant plus.
- Expertise in software development in relevant languages (any of Java, Python, Go, Rust, C++, etc).
- Proven problem-solving skills, especially in troubleshooting complex issues in distributed systems.
- Strong written and verbal communication abilities.
While not required, it’s an added plus if you also have
- Proficiency in cloud computing platforms such as AWS, Azure, or Google Cloud.
- Familiarity with containerization technologies like Docker and orchestration platforms like Kubernetes.
- Previous experience working with AI/ML, distributed systems, HPC, and systems/infrastructure is a plus.
Employee Benefits:
- Flexible work hours
- Competitive salary & Equity
- Tools Stipend
- Health, Dental, Vision and Life Insurance
- Short Term and Long Term Disability
- Unlimited Paid Time Off + Holidays. We focus on trust and ownership, not time in the chair
- Numerous company social events
We will do everything we can within reason to make sure that your interview takes place in an environment that fairly and accurately assesses your skills. If you need assistance or accommodation, please contact your recruiter.
Augment Code is proud to be an Equal Employment Opportunity employer. We do not discriminate based upon race, religion, color, national origin, gender (including pregnancy, childbirth, or related medical conditions), sexual orientation, gender identity, gender expression, age, status as a protected veteran, status as an individual with a disability, or other applicable legally protected characteristics.
By applying for this job, the candidate acknowledges and agrees that any personal data contained in their application or supporting materials will be processed in accordance with Augment Code's Applicant Privacy Policy.
Pay Transparency Notice: The actual base salary within the stated range will be based on a combination of factors such as an individual's skills, experience level, educational background, and other relevant job-related considerations.